Chemical and Electro-Chemical Engineering focuses on the design, development, and optimization of chemical processes and electrochemical systems to produce valuable materials, energy, and products. It integrates principles from chemistry, thermodynamics, transport phenomena, and electrochemistry to solve challenges in sectors such as energy storage, corrosion protection, water treatment, pharmaceuticals, and materials manufacturing.
The four-year undergraduate program in Chemical and Electro-Chemical Engineering equips students with a strong foundation in both theoretical and practical aspects of chemical engineering and electrochemical technologies. The curriculum covers key areas such as reaction engineering, process control, electrochemical engineering, material science, corrosion engineering, and renewable energy systems. With a focus on innovation and sustainable solutions, the program prepares students for careers in industries, research, and entrepreneurship.
